Size: a a a

React — русскоговорящее сообщество

2021 April 20

ЕБ

Евгений Баранников... in React — русскоговорящее сообщество
нет, не внутри map. Нужно, если key передан, задействовать его как атрибут
источник

DP

Dmitry Plyaskin in React — русскоговорящее сообщество
ты похоже не понимаешь как key в реакте работает
источник

ЕБ

Евгений Баранников... in React — русскоговорящее сообщество
точнее, может быть и внутри map
источник

M

Michael in React — русскоговорящее сообщество
напиши хотя бы так
<div key={key || index} />
источник

M

Michael in React — русскоговорящее сообщество
и не надо вонючего ифа
источник

ЕБ

Евгений Баранников... in React — русскоговорящее сообщество
вопрос не в этом, как опциально только атрибут задействовать
источник

M

Michael in React — русскоговорящее сообщество
точнее не
источник

M

Michael in React — русскоговорящее сообщество
<div key={key ?? index} />
источник

DP

Dmitry Plyaskin in React — русскоговорящее сообщество
<div {...someParams} />
источник

M

Michael in React — русскоговорящее сообщество
вот так
источник

ЕБ

Евгений Баранников... in React — русскоговорящее сообщество
сердцем чувствую, оно )))
источник

ЕБ

Евгений Баранников... in React — русскоговорящее сообщество
спасибо)
источник

M

Maxym in React — русскоговорящее сообщество
Я бы подправил таким образом:  https://codepen.io/Noorama/pen/WNRaZqp

Конечно, можно и лучше, но работает, как вам нужно, скорее всего.
Несколько замечаний: Вы в локалстор не можете хранить данные в формате булиан - там будет лежать строковое значение. И когда вы его считываете - вы получаете строку, а не true | false. Так же useEffect вам ненужен в данном контексте - вы можете получать данные в качестве дефолтного значения стейта напрямую прокинув в setState(defaultData). Еще вместо animation в css я использовал transition.
источник

M

Maxym in React — русскоговорящее сообщество
А... у вас данные какие-то фетчятся.. ну тогда да - либо прокидывайте через пропсы в дефолтное значение useState, либо через useEffect - тоже должно сработать нормально.
источник

X

Xamarin in React — русскоговорящее сообщество
Ребята, всем привет, кто нибудь работал с переводами (по типу i18n)? Как правильно организовать наименование ключей? По типу группировки общих и конкретных
источник

V

Vlad in React — русскоговорящее сообщество
источник

AC

Angly Cat in React — русскоговорящее сообщество
Читается сложно. Будто это написал выходец из олимпиадного программирования.
источник

AC

Angly Cat in React — русскоговорящее сообщество
Судя даже по тому, что условие не инвертировано
источник

AC

Angly Cat in React — русскоговорящее сообщество
Имхо стоило бы экономить не строчки кода, а время коллег
источник

AC

Angly Cat in React — русскоговорящее сообщество
Нет "правильного" подхода.
источник